California Bans Legacy Admissions

Diverse: Issues in Higher Education

California has banned legacy admissions, making it illegal for public and private universities in the state to consider an applicant’s relationship to alumni or donors when deciding whether to admit them. 1, 2025, is the nation’s fifth legacy admissions ban, but only the second that will apply to private colleges. “In

Adler University Announces Tenure Program

Diverse: Issues in Higher Education

The Chicago-based institution which provides master's and doctoral degrees, said that all full-time Adler faculty will have the opportunity to apply for tenure upon completing five years of service at the University and achieving the rank of associate professor.
